- Abstract : The main thesis of this paper is the following: Already in his Critique of Political Economy in 1859 and more forcefully in Capital in 1867, Marx relies on two distinct kinds of abstraction in order to introduce and explain Value. The first kind of abstraction – which I call abstraction1 or 'Aristotelian abstraction' – takes it that two (or more) actual commodities, despite their vast difference ('atom for atom') in their concrete material individuality, can contain the same quantity of Abstract General Labour (AGL). The second kind of abstraction – abstraction2 – is of substantially different form: it replies on an abstraction principle which introduces Value on the basis of an equivalence relation that is defined on commodities qua concrete material entities (what he calls 'use-values'), which however contain the same amount of AGL. This second kind of abstraction allows him to perform a path-breaking move in the theory of value, viz., to introduce a new sort of (abstract) entity (Value) which he implicitly defines by means of reconceptualisation of the content of statements which capture an equivalence relation among, ultimately, concrete commodities (use-values), which, however, contain the same amount of AGL.
